Qatar has once again made its presence felt on the international broadband arena. The Emirate recently jumped two spots to become the country to boost the highest growth in household broadband usage in Q1-2011.

According to data from Point Topic, a leading websource on broadband statistics and country analysis, broadband penetration in Qatar skyrocketed at a time when broadband expansion in USA – a country famous for its internet escapades – stalled.
In comparison to Q4-2010 statistics, Qatar jumped two spots to lead Liechtenstein and Luxembourg in household penetration of broadband. United Arab Emirates and Bahrain also made it to the top ten rankings.
